Market making involves simultaneously maintaining buy and sell orders across multiple price points, creating order book depth that facilitates smooth trading. The bot places limit orders on both sides of the current price, ensuring traders can execute orders without excessive slippage. This liquidity provision attracts larger traders who might otherwise avoid thin markets.

The spread management algorithm automatically adjusts bid-ask spreads based on market volatility and volume conditions. During high volatility periods, spreads widen to protect against adverse selection, while calm markets see tighter spreads that maximize capital efficiency. This dynamic adjustment maintains profitability for the market making operation while providing competitive pricing.

Inventory management represents a critical component of effective market making. The bot monitors its net position in the token and adjusts order placement to maintain neutral exposure over time. If the bot accumulates excess token inventory, it shifts toward sell-side liquidity provision; conversely, SOL accumulation triggers increased buy-side activity. This balancing prevents directional risk while maintaining continuous liquidity.

Limitations and Considerations

While volume generation provides powerful advantages, understanding limitations and potential drawbacks ensures realistic expectations and ethical usage. No tool guarantees success regardless of underlying project quality, and volume automation comes with inherent constraints that users must navigate thoughtfully.

Cost considerations can become prohibitive for sustained campaigns, especially during high-competition periods. Gas fees on Solana, while low relative to other chains, accumulate significantly across thousands of transactions. Projects must carefully calculate return on investment to ensure volume generation remains economically viable. In some cases, organic community building might provide better value than continued bot operation.

Detection risks, while minimized through sophisticated algorithms, never reach zero. Platforms continuously evolve their detection mechanisms, and patterns that appear organic today might trigger flags tomorrow. Relying solely on automated volume without genuine community development creates fragility—any detection or platform policy change could eliminate your competitive advantage instantly.

Ethical considerations deserve serious contemplation. While volume generation exists in a gray area rather than clearly prohibited, creating false perceptions of market interest raises questions about trader protection and market integrity. Projects should consider whether volume automation aligns with their values and how transparent they want to be with their community about growth tactics.

Market conditions significantly impact effectiveness. During extremely competitive periods with numerous well-funded projects competing for trending slots, even substantial volume investments might prove insufficient. The bot provides advantages but cannot overcome fundamental market dynamics when competition intensifies beyond threshold levels. Strategic timing becomes as important as the tool itself.

Technical limitations include dependency on platform uptime, RPC reliability, and blockchain network health. During Solana congestion events or RPC outages, bot effectiveness degrades regardless of configuration quality. Users need contingency plans and realistic expectations about availability during stressed network conditions.

Long-term sustainability represents perhaps the most significant consideration. Volume bots create temporary competitive advantages that diminish as adoption spreads. Eventually, most serious projects might employ similar tools, returning to equilibrium where genuine differentiation determines success. Planning for this eventual parity by building lasting value remains essential for projects seeking longevity beyond initial launch phases.
